Investors Interested In Acadia Healthcare Company, Inc.'s (NASDAQ:ACHC) Revenues

It's not a stretch to say that Acadia Healthcare Company, Inc.'s (NASDAQ:ACHC) price-to-sales (or "P/S") ratio of 1.3x right now seems quite "middle-of-the-road" for companies in the Healthcare industry in the United States, where the median P/S ratio is around 1.2x. However, investors might be overlooking a clear opportunity or potential setback if there is no rational basis for the P/S.

How Is Acadia Healthcare Company's Revenue Growth Trending?

Acadia Healthcare Company's P/S ratio would be typical for a company that's only expected to deliver moderate growth, and importantly, perform in line with the industry.

If we review the last year of revenue growth, the company posted a worthy increase of 9.1%. Pleasingly, revenue has also lifted 38% in aggregate from three years ago, partly thanks to the last 12 months of growth. Accordingly, shareholders would have definitely welcomed those medium-term rates of revenue growth.

Looking ahead now, revenue is anticipated to climb by 9.0% per year during the coming three years according to the twelve analysts following the company. Meanwhile, the rest of the industry is forecast to expand by 8.3% per year, which is not materially different.

In light of this, it's understandable that Acadia Healthcare Company's P/S sits in line with the majority of other companies. Apparently shareholders are comfortable to simply hold on while the company is keeping a low profile.

The Final Word

It's argued the price-to-sales ratio is an inferior measure of value within certain industries, but it can be a powerful business sentiment indicator.

Our look at Acadia Healthcare Company's revenue growth estimates show that its P/S is about what we expect, as both metrics follow closely with the industry averages. At this stage investors feel the potential for an improvement or deterioration in revenue isn't great enough to push P/S in a higher or lower direction. Unless these conditions change, they will continue to support the share price at these levels.
